Daniel O’Connell Division Formed

ANCIENT ORDER OF HIBERNIANS FORMS NEW DIVISION DANIEL O’CONNELL – UNION #2

Honoring Elizabeth Division – Same Name and Number

On September 28th, the Daniel O’Connell Division was formed, and its members installed from Union County at the Cranford Elks on Lincoln Avenue East. This effort was in the making for several months and completed yesterday.

National Vice President Sean Pender stated, “Last night I was proud to invest the new officers of the Daniel O’Connell Division #2 of Union County NJ. This division had been inactive for several years due to an aging small group of members on our rolls.

Thanks to State President Richie O’Brien’s determination and Organizer Bill Young they collaborated with Tim O’Brien and local Irish American community groups, and we have 30 new members that have been or will be sworn in.  The best part is that this is NJ’s oldest charter from June 18, 1868, or 154 years old. So, we were able to save that history and re-establish the AOH in Union County.

Personally, I want to thank Richie and Bill for their great work; this was the division I first joined in 1981 and also where Richie’s grandfather used to bring him to the old clubhouse when he was young”.
